How Our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Service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that every aspect of the restoration is taken care of. We start by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the leak. Next, we’ll extract any standing water and use specialized equipment to dry the area. We’ll then repair or replace any damaged materials and finally, we’ll restore your laundry room to its original condition.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ll arrive at your property and assess the damage to find out the extent of the restoration needed. Our team will identify the source of the leak and create a plan to address it. We’ll also take photos and notes to document the damage for insurance purposes.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ment to extract any standing water from your laundry room.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and promoting a safe environment for our technicians to work in.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use advanced equipment to dry your laundry room and prevent further damage. Our team will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ent mold growth.

Step 4: Repair and Replacement

We’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inets. Our team will work to match the original materials and finishes to ensure a seamless restoration.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the restoration is complete and to your satisfaction. We’ll also clean and disinfect the area to prevent any further damage or health risks.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ak (less than 1 gallon per minute) Yes No You can likely fix the leak and dry the area yourself.
Large leak (over 1 gallon per minute) No Yes A large leak can cause significant damage and needs professional attention.
Standing water (over 2 inches deep) No Yes Standing water can cause mold growth and needs professional equipment to dry.
Structural damage (e.g., warped or buckled flooring) No Yes Structural damage needs professional repair and may involve more costs.
Hidden dam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) No Yes Hidden dam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Dallas, GA

The cost of laundry room water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$1,500 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Repair and replacement $1,500 – $5,000 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Final inspection and cleaning $500 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Insurance claims processing $500 – $1,000 Complexity of the claims process and insurance coverage
